1.How does the electronic gas flow meter detect the properties of the target fluid?
As one of the electronic gas flow meter market leaders, we are known for innovation and reliability.
Flow meters measure the flow rate of a fluid by detecting the velocity of the fluid. This is typically done by measuring the pressure drop across a known restriction in the flow path, or by measuring the velocity of the fluid using a variety of technologies such as ultrasonic, magnetic, or thermal. The flow rate can then be used to calculate the properties of the fluid, such as density, viscosity, and volumetric flow rate.

5.How to calibrate a electronic gas flow meter?
Being one of the top electronic gas flow meter manufacturers in China, We attach great importance to this detail.
1. Check the manufacturer’s instructions for the specific flow meter you are using.
2. Make sure the flow meter is installed correctly and that all connections are secure.
3. Connect the flow meter to a calibration device, such as a flow calibration rig or a flow calibration loop.
4. Set the calibration device to the desired flow rate.
5. Turn on the flow meter and allow it to run for a few minutes to ensure that it is stable.
6. Check the flow meter’s reading against the calibration device’s reading.
7. Adjust the flow meter’s settings as necessary to match the calibration device’s reading.
8. Repeat steps 4-7 until the flow meter’s reading matches the calibration device’s reading.
9. Record the flow meter’s settings and the calibration device’s reading for future reference.

13.What are the maintenance methods for electronic gas flow meter?
We focus on innovation and continuous improvement to maintain a competitive advantage.
1. Regularly check the flow meter for any signs of wear or damage.
2. Clean the flow meter regularly to ensure accurate readings.
3. Check the accuracy of the flow meter by performing calibration tests.
4. Replace any worn or damaged parts as soon as possible.
5. Ensure that the flow meter is properly installed and connected to the system.
6. Check the flow meter for any signs of corrosion or blockages.
7. Ensure that the flow meter is properly sealed to prevent any leaks.
8. Regularly check the flow meter for any signs of vibration or noise.
9. Ensure that the flow meter is properly calibrated and adjusted.
10. Regularly check the flow meter for any signs of leakage or clogging.
